    The Samsung Galaxy Note 5 ( stylized as SΛMSUNG Galaxy Note5) is an Android -based smartphone designed, developed, produced and marketed by Samsung Electronics. Unveiled on 13 August 2015, [ 9] it is the successor to the Galaxy Note 4 and part of the Samsung Galaxy Note series . The Galaxy Note 5 carries over hardware and software features ...

    The Samsung Galaxy S5 is an Android-based smartphone unveiled, produced, released and marketed by Samsung Electronics as part of the Samsung Galaxy S series. Unveiled on 24 February 2014 at Mobile World Congress in Barcelona , Spain , it was released on 11 April 2014 in 150 countries as the immediate successor to the Galaxy S4 .

    The Samsung Galaxy Tab S3 is an Android -based tablet computer produced and marketed by Samsung Electronics. [ 1] Belonging to the high-end "S" line, it was unveiled alongside the Galaxy Book at the MWC 2017, and was first released on March 24, 2017. It is available in Wi-Fi only and Wi-Fi/ 4G LTE variants.
